What each one is

The product in its own terms, so the numbers below have context.

Ansible

Ansible is an open source IT automation engine that automates provisioning, configuration management, application deployment, orchestration, and many other IT processes. It is free to use, and the project benefits from the experience and intelligence of its thousands of contributors.

Independently observed

BOSH

A tool chain for automating the release engineering, deployment, and ongoing management of complex distributed services. It supports multiple cloud platforms and can manage itself through self-hosting.
